Van Gogh Starry Night Over The Rhone Starry Night Over the Rhône ( September 1888, French: Nuit étoilée sur le Rhône) is one of Vincent van Gogh's paintings of Arles at nighttime. The lights of the town of Arles are reflected in the water of the Rhône, while the stars themselves light up the sky above. Located at Musée d'Orsay. Vincent Van Gogh Starry Night Over the Rhone was painted at night in the city and commune in the south of France, Arles. Here his stars glow with a luminescence, shining from the dark, blue and velvety night sky. Above the river, one can discern the stars of the familiar Big Dipper asterism. This spot proved ideal for Van Gogh, as he had grown increasingly interested in the effects of light—particularly, the artificial illumination of gas lamps—at night. Every canvas print is hand-crafted in the USA, made on-demand at iCanvas and expertly stretched … The night sky and the effects of light at night provided the subject for some of his more famous paintings, including The Starry Night, the most famous Van Gogh night stars painting. Though full of vibrant energy, the scene is calm; the only people present in the composition are “two colorful figurines of lovers in the foreground,” and, despite its sparkling stars, the sky elicits a sense of tranquility. Starry Night Over the Rhône (September 1888) is one of Vincent van Gogh's paintings of Arles at nighttime. By juxtaposing yellow against blue, Van Gogh adeptly conveys how the heat of the lights burns upon the cold water.
